
Chelsea midfielder Cole Palmer will be out of action for another half a month due to an abdominal injury. This was reported by Euro-football.ru.
The team's head coach Enzo Maresca announced this. Maresca stated that earlier information about Cole returning to the field in November was incorrect.
Unfortunately, he will need another six weeks to recover. Surgery will not be performed, and the medical team is trying to protect the player as much as possible.
They hope that the six-week period will be sufficient for his health to recover. This season, 23-year-old Palmer has played in four matches and scored two goals.
Chelsea's next match will be against Nottingham Forest on October 18.
